项目摘要
The aim of this proposal is to further study the nature of the
unique liver mitochondria carbonic anhydrase, CAmit. We have
found that incubating intact mitochondria with substrates for
citrullinogenesis plus the sulfonamide carbonic anhydrase inhibitor
acetazolamide results in decreased citrulline production. Our
hypothesis is that the function of CAmit is to provide the
substrate HCO3- for the first urea cycle enzyme, the
mitochondrially located carbamyl phosphate synthetase I. We will
determine if there are any other effects of the sulfonamides on
the mitochondria. We have also found that incubating intact
hepatocytes with substrates for ureagenesis plus sulfonamide
carbonic anhydrase inhibitors results in decreased urea
production, but that greater than 1000-fold the concentration is
needed compared with inhibition of citrullinogenesis. We will
determine what it is in the hepatocyte that binds on to
sulfonamides. We will determine whether CAmit activity is
increased by the same factors which increase if CAmit can be
inhibited in the whole body, and what this effect would be.
本提案的目的是进一步研究
独特的肝线粒体碳酸酐酶,CAmit。 我们有
发现将完整的线粒体与底物一起孵育
瓜氨酸生成加上磺酰胺碳酸酐酶抑制剂
乙酰唑胺会导致瓜氨酸产量减少。 我们的
假设 CAmit 的功能是提供
第一个尿素循环酶的底物 HCO3-
位于线粒体的氨甲酰磷酸合成酶 I。我们将
确定磺胺类药物是否有任何其他影响
线粒体。 我们还发现,孵化完好无损
具有尿素生成底物加磺酰胺的肝细胞
碳酸酐酶抑制剂导致尿素减少
产量,但浓度大于 1000 倍
与抑制瓜氨酸生成相比需要。 我们将
确定肝细胞中结合的是什么
磺胺类药物。 我们将确定 CAmit 活动是否
如果 CAmit 可以增加,则增加相同的因素
全身受到抑制,会产生什么影响。
